KO2's client, a global leader in cutting-edge vehicle and asset telematics, is seeking an experienced electronics engineer to join their Belfast-based team. With a workforce of 250 globally (55 in Belfast), this German corporate specializes in IoT solutions for trucks, LTE, BLE, wireless communication systems, and telematic devices.
The company's innovative products provide real-time data on vehicle behaviour, driving style, location, and asset tracking. From solar-powered tracking devices to video telematics and advanced sensing devices, their next- solutions are revolutionizing the transportation and logistics industries.
About the Role
As a senior electronics engineer, you will play a pivotal role in the design and development of telematics and IoT devices. Your expertise will contribute to creating solutions that integrate GNSS, cellular modules, BLE, CAN protocols, and various sensors. You’ll work on Altium-based hardware design, ensuring seamless operation across battery-powered and solar-powered devices.
